Diane Jacoby as Ophelia, a young Florida Suffragist in the early 1900s

On Saturday, August 8, 2026, from 2:00 to 3:00 p.m., Historical Dramatist Diane Jacoby presents her one-woman show introducing the audience to "Ophelia," a young woman from Florida who became a suffragist and marched in Washington, D.C. 

While Ophelia's Victorian mother wanted her daughter to become a debutant, Ophelia learned about women fighting for the right to vote and was drawn to join them. Dramatist Diane Jacoby wrote and performs as Ophelia, enabling the audience to learn about women's fight for the vote and the young individuals who took up the signs and joined the demonstrations. 

This performance raises funds for the Emergency Services and Homeless Coalition of St. Johns County, specifically to support the organization's efforts to stabilize families and help them attain safe and affordable housing.
